Mrs Winnister's body was found at 9.15pm, reportedly by the partner of one of her nieces after she failed to respond to calls. (Image: Grant Falvey/LNP)Close friend Lynda Idle, a retired pub boss, said Mrs Winnister was "nicest person you could ever meet". Neighbours said Mrs Winnister was "always looking out for others". Former neighbours of the Winnisters' former home, also in Bexley, were devastated after learning of Mrs Winnister's death.
